Subject: Handover — Usermod split, cycle 31

Taking over from me: the Bramblewick user module is now extracted from the Corvid monolith. Auth routes cut over Tuesday; profile routes pending. Canary at 10%, holding steady. Freeze window ends Friday.

You'll need the new signing key for the userd release pipeline:

signing key of fahip-yahop = bky9_btHA9MfNr

// REINDEX_BATCH_CAP limits docs per shard pass in the Tallowfield
// nightly search reindex. Raising it starves the ingest queue;
// lowering it overruns the maintenance window. 5000 is the tested
// sweet spot. Change only with a soak run. Verified against the
// build noted below.

session token of bawif-hahog = htk6_ac5981

Subject: Handover — GraphQL N+1 fix

Hema,

Before the eng sync: the resolver batching fix for Orchardline's GraphQL API is deployed to staging. DataLoader now batches author lookups; query count per request dropped from ~340 to 4. Watch p95 latency on the reports endpoint this week. One stored procedure still needs an index — ticket filed. To verify query counts yourself, connect to the staging replica with this string.

replica DSN, yahaf-yagaf: mongodb://tamath_svc:a2netSk3RZMuTj@db-d084.novacsoft.internal:5432/ralmir

Subject: Fire drill tomorrow — quick heads-up

Hi all,

Friendly reminder from the front desk: we've got a fire drill tomorrow at 10:30. Contractors, please gather at the muster point by the Larkspur Building loading dock so Marta can tick you off the roll call. Don't prop doors on your way out! To get back in afterwards, use the side entrance with the temporary pass below.

staff pass of kawip-hawef = bdg-QLP-2